When the Lambda Phi Epsilon Alumni Association (LPEAA) was started, the fund was created with Clarkson by Ken Love #32 and Bill Volk #38 in 1975.  It has been increasing in size ever since from Alumni donations. 

Student loans from the fund have been used by many ΤΕΦ brothers over the years.  The loans have been repaid with interest, thereby replenishing and adding to the fund. 

As of 1/10/19 there is $19,028.90 in the fund.

Any Clarkson student that is a brother of the Tau Epsilon Phi fraternity is eligible for the loan.  Clarkson administers the loan and typically makes $2-3,000 available each year for student loans.  This makes sure the loans are staggered and there are loan amounts available yearly.
